  • 15. 阅读理解

        Volunteering means spending some of your free time helping others. You may volunteer to help other people, such as the families who lost their homes after a natural disaster. And you can also volunteer to protect animals, the environment, or any other things that you care about.

        Help yourself by helping others.

        Volunteering helps others, but it can also help you. If you're upset about something, volunteering can be a great way to cope (应付) with your feelings. Lots of people find that they really enjoy volunteering. Volunteer experiences often put you in a different environment that you wouldn't have met in your life.

        Get started

        School is a good place to start if you're looking for volunteer ideas. Ask a teacher for ideas. Some places want volunteers who are 12 or even older, depending on the job. Often kids start volunteering by working alongside their parents.

        Do things with parents or family members.

        Volunteering is a great way to have fun with your family. Talk to your parents, brothers, or sisters and see what they might be interested in doing. Find something you all agree on.

        Invent your own opportunity

        Kids can also come up with their own ways to raise money or provide needed services. Here are some ideas: 1. Make and sell products and give the money to the charity. 2. Collect or earn money for charities. 3. Start your own charity group.

        Some schools now need kids to help others. Why? Because grown-ups hope kids will become caring people who see the value of giving of their time, talents, and things (like money, toys, or clothes). Volunteering gives kids a taste of responsibility because people are depending on them for something important.

        Volunteering can also help kids learn important things about themselves-like what kinds of things they're best at and enjoy the most. A volunteer job can even help some kids decide what they want to do when they grow up. So what are you waiting for? Make a plan to start volunteering today!

    Why losing Kobe Bryant felt like losing a family or friend?

        A basketball player named Kobe Bryant died on January 26. He died in a helicopter crash(直升机坠毁). His 13-year-old daughter, Gianna, also died in the crash, along with seven others.

        People were very sad about it. This happened even if they had not met him. How do people feel sad over a stranger? Why do they think of Mr. Bryant as family? As a scientist, I am not surprised. I see why his death hurt some people.

        ⒈Social Media Keeps Us Close

        Scientists have looked at how people form ties with other people. These can be people we have not met. Still, we feel close to them. Many people are on social media. They follow celebrities(名人) online. They see the good and bad times of famous people. Fans can feel close to the people they follow on social media. Mr. Bryant had many followers online. He had many fans.

        ⒉It Shouldn't Have Happened That Way

        Mr. Bryant's death seemed extra sad. This can make people think “what if” thoughts. When we see ways to fix something, it can bring strong feelings. We might say, “If it had been a clear day, Kobe would still be alive.” We feel like it should not have happened that way, it is hard for us to believe the truth.

        ⒊Thinking About Our Lives

        Our feelings may be about ourselves. Many people felt like they had gotten to know Mr. Bryant. They watched him play basketball on TV. His death was sad. Thinking about dying can scare us. We want to give our lives meaning. We get together with loved ones. Mr. Bryant's death was a reminder. It reminds us that life is short.
